Python Developer at AIO

Python Developer

🏢 Company:
AIO
📍 Location:
Islamabad, Islāmābād, Pakistan
💼 Job Type:
Full-time
⏱️ Employment:
Full-time

💰 Compensation

Not specified

📋 Job Description

About The RoleAs a Python Developer – AI at AIO, you will play a key role in building and scaling our AI-powered backend systems. You will be responsible for developing high-performance FastAPI services, integrating LLMs into live production environments, and ensuring seamless collaboration across AI, front-end, and DevOps teams. This role will involve designing secure and scalable microservices, managing databases with SQLAlchemy, and applying best practices in testing, performance, and cloud deployment. You’ll also contribute to the optimization of AI model deployments, monitor system health in production, and help shape innovative solutions that drive real business value for our customers in the US restaurant industry.What will be your responsibilities?Design and develop high-performance FastAPI services using asynchronous patterns and clean architecture principles.Implement and maintain both microservice-based and monolithic applications as per module complexity and scalability needs.Integrate AI/LLM models with live backend systems to automate and optimize restaurant operations.Experience with backend distributed asynchronous processing through frameworks like CeleryBuild and manage database schemas using SQLAlchemy, ensuring consistency, speed, and security.Collaborate with AI, front-end, and DevOps teams to ensure smooth E2E system flows.Document and version APIs using Swagger/OpenAPI standardsStay current with Python, AI, and cloud-native advancements to drive innovation.Ensure AI solutions adhere to best practices in software engineering, including unit testing, integration testing, performance testing, and load testing.Participate in the design and optimization of microservices architectures and message broker systems to support AI model deployment.Implement data visualization, monitoring, and alerting tools to track AI model performance and system health in production.Apply security best practices for APIs and sensitive data handling (OAuth2, JWT, etc.).What are we looking for, and what does it require to be the right fit for this role?Bachelor’s or master’s degree in computer science, AI, or a related field.1-2 years of backend development experience in Python with AI integrations, including FastAPIHands-on experience with LLMs (GPT-4, Claude, LLaMA, Mistral, Mixtral), and their APIs.Practical experience in integrating AI models or LLMs into production-grade APIsExpertise in cloud environments such as AWS with hands-on experience in services like Lambda/Serverless, SQS, S3, EC2 and ECS.Strong skills in Git for source control, code review, and repository management.Experience with containerization technologies like Docker and managing microservices architectures.Expertise in building highly distributed, eventually consistent AI systems.Familiarity with message broker systems and scalable data pipelines.Experience with data visualization, monitoring, and alerting tools to maintain production of AI models.Excellent knowledge of Relational Databases, SQL, and ORM technologies like SQLAlchemy, Redis, and queuing.Why Join AIO?Our mission is to revolutionize the US restaurant industry by providing a comprehensive and fully integrated solution that empowers restaurant owners to efficiently manage all aspects of their business. Our platform combines our patented AI technology with unparalleled customer support to help owners increase revenue, reduce costs, and improve their overall profit margins.We believe that restaurants should be able to focus on delivering exceptional dining experiences to their customers, without the added stress of managing complex and disparate systems. That’s why we offer an All-In-One super app platform for all their needs, from front-of-the-house operations like ordering, payment, marketing, and rewards, to back-of-the-house management like inventory, staff, and financials.We are laser focused on becoming a significant player in the 55 billion restaurant tech SaaS market. You will be a part of a world class, up-and-coming Silicon Valley funded startup. What will be your responsibilities? Design and develop high-performance FastAPI services using asynchronous patterns and clean architecture principles.Implement and maintain both microservice-based and monolithic applications as per module complexity and scalability needs.Integrate AI/LLM models with live backend systems to automate and optimize restaurant operations.Experience with backend distributed asynchronous processing through frameworks like CeleryBuild and manage database schemas using SQLAlchemy, ensuring consistency, speed, and security.Collaborate with AI, front-end, and DevOps teams to ensure smooth E2E system flows.Document and version APIs using Swagger/OpenAPI standardsStay current with Python, AI, and cloud-native advancements to drive innovation.Ensure AI solutions adhere to best practices in software engineering, including unit testing, integration testing, performance testing, and load testing.Participate in

📚 Qualifications

📊 Experience Required: 1-2 years of backend development experience

⭐ Seniority Level: Entry level

🎯 Job Function: Engineering and Information Technology

🏢 About the Company

See who AIO has hired for this role

ℹ️ Additional Information

🏭 Industries: Technology, Information and Internet

👥 Number of Applicants: Over 200

📅 Posted Date: December 17, 2025

📍 Source: LinkedIn

Job ID: 47c279f88df642d5a70a37741c6ebad6

💡 Tip: Research the company, tailor your resume, and prepare thoughtful questions for the interview!

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top